[master] 4caac9525 fix json format glitch

Nils Goroll nils.goroll at uplex.de
Wed Mar 6 15:26:07 UTC 2019


commit 4caac9525ccd2c9903696f18493255e995c4c874
Author: Nils Goroll <nils.goroll at uplex.de>
Date:   Wed Mar 6 16:12:21 2019 +0100

    fix json format glitch
    
    Ref #2896

diff --git a/lib/libvmod_directors/fall_back.c b/lib/libvmod_directors/fall_back.c
index 88efb699b..50df8c799 100644
--- a/lib/libvmod_directors/fall_back.c
+++ b/lib/libvmod_directors/fall_back.c
@@ -118,7 +118,7 @@ vmod_fallback_list(VRT_CTX, VCL_BACKEND dir, struct vsb *vsb, int pflag,
 	if (jflag && (pflag)) {
 		VSB_cat(vsb, "\n");
 		VSB_indent(vsb, -2);
-		VSB_cat(vsb, "},\n");
+		VSB_cat(vsb, "}\n");
 		VSB_indent(vsb, -2);
 		VSB_cat(vsb, "},\n");
 	}
diff --git a/lib/libvmod_directors/vdir.c b/lib/libvmod_directors/vdir.c
index 1caab2e3c..e3495be76 100644
--- a/lib/libvmod_directors/vdir.c
+++ b/lib/libvmod_directors/vdir.c
@@ -256,7 +256,7 @@ vdir_list(VRT_CTX, struct vdir *vd, struct vsb *vsb, int pflag, int jflag,
 	if (jflag && (pflag)) {
 		VSB_cat(vsb, "\n");
 		VSB_indent(vsb, -2);
-		VSB_cat(vsb, "},\n");
+		VSB_cat(vsb, "}\n");
 		VSB_indent(vsb, -2);
 		VSB_cat(vsb, "},\n");
 	}


More information about the varnish-commit mailing list